Herbert Brün
Herbert Brün (1918–2000) was a German composer and university teacher.
Also recorded as Herbert Bruen.
Overview
Born at Berlin in 1918, died at Urbana in 2000.
In detail
Herbert Brün studied at Experimental Music Studios. Horacio Vaggione is recorded as having studied under Herbert Brün. the recorded working language is German.
Subjects and genres recorded for the work are classical and jazz.
Employment is recorded with University of Illinois Urbana-Champaign.
